Skipton Gala have announced via facebook this year's Skipton Gala Queen following the selection evening that took place.
Delilah Gray was picked to wear the crown this year.
Each year young people in Skipton can apply to be the gala's King or Queen and attendants.
Queen Delilah will attend Skipton's Gala on 14th June 2025 as well as representing Skipton at other Galas.
With her will be her attendants which this year are Joshua Gaunt and Cara Hextall.
The trio were picked at the selection ceremony at Alexander's on 19th March with a red carpet entrance.

Skipton Gala took to Facebook to announce the new Queen saying:
"A heartfelt thank you to all our applicants — your enthusiasm and spirit made the judges’ decision incredibly difficult.
"We’d also like to extend our sincere gratitude to our panel of judges for their time and thoughtful consideration.
A special thank you to the team at Alexander's for hosting such a fantastic selection evening.
"Your hospitality truly made the night one to remember.
Here’s to a fantastic Skipton Gala 2025!"
